More Than 15 Years in the Making
The Company of the Year award is presented to business partners who have shown significant support and meaningful involvement with the Craft Guild of Chefs over the past year. But in Adande’s case, the recognition reflects something far greater than a single year’s work.
Andrew Green noted that Adande’s partnership with the Craft Guild stretches back well over 15 years, a relationship built on consistent support, genuine involvement and a shared commitment to the culinary profession. As Andrew put it, year after year, the support from Adande has continued and that consistency is exactly what the award celebrates.
All Our Members Have Adande in Their Pockets
One of the things Andrew highlighted that clearly resonated with the Guild is Adande’s sponsorship of the membership card issued to every new Craft Guild member. It might sound like a small gesture, but as Andrew pointed out, it’s anything but.
Every chef who joins the Craft Guild of Chefs receives their membership card with the Adande logo on it. That means every new member, at the very start of their journey with the Guild, has Adande in their pocket. It’s a moment of connection between a brand and a culinary professional that begins before they’ve even stepped into their first sponsored event or seen an Adande unit in a kitchen.
For Adande, sponsoring that card has never been about visibility alone. It’s about backing the next generation of culinary talent and demonstrating a genuine commitment to the profession, not just the industry.
